About Arlington II Child Care Center
4-Star Early Learning Studio in Arlington
Arlington II Headstart & Child Development Center has been a pillar of the community since 1992, operating under the renowned Child Care Associates network. As a designated 'Early Learning Studio,' the facility moves beyond traditional daycare models to provide a mission-driven, high-quality educational environment. The program is specifically designed to support the 'whole child,' integrating education with essential health and nutritional support to ensure every student is on a path to a successful future. Led by Director Anna Chapa, the center maintains a prestigious Texas Rising Star 4-star rating, the highest quality mark awarded by the state. The classrooms are vibrant spaces filled with age-appropriate learning tools, from specialized block areas to literacy nooks. Parents often highlight the 'family feeling' of the center, citing a unique policy where teachers often stay with the same group of children as they age up, providing much-needed consistency during early development...

Safety Record
No specific safety concerns, major violations, or legal incidents were found for this location. The facility has been a state-licensed child care center since July 1992 (License #412627) and maintains a licensed capacity of 120 children.
Parent Reputation
The center is designated as a Texas Rising Star (TRS) 4-star provider, the highest quality rating awarded by the state for excellence in early childhood programs. Staff Insights
Employee reviews for Child Care Associates (the parent organization) highlight a mission-driven culture and exceptional benefits for the industry, such as medical, dental, and vision coverage. Some staff reports indicate the work environment is fast-paced and high-stress due to regulatory requirements and multitasking.
